Of course I was seated next to Cyrus as per Lana's intervention on the bus.

We're part of the same unit responsible for the equipment, and with Lana being in charge, she went out of her way to push Kernel aside and command Cyrus to the back to sit next to me.

She seated several others, but I felt like this was done intentionally. In any case, I didn't mind.

I did, and I kind of didn't.

I tried hard to keep my eyes focused on the window, I felt like there was a slight air of awkwardness remembering the shattering glass incident.

I know it wasn't a big deal, but for some reason it was to me.

Like how could I have just dropped it like that. Such an idiot, ugh.

Cyrus shifts from next to me, and I get the sense that he may be feeling... awkward too? Uncomfortable?

The vehicle finally starts and he stops shifting and settles down in his seat, a giant bag on his lap.

"So...how you feeling? Ready for this?" He asks looking at me,

I turn around, instantly met by an intense gaze, and oh my- his eyes were simply mesmerizing.

"I can't believe it's real; that this is actually happening."

"Yeah, I know it's insane." He pauses, then as if pulling from memory he follows up with,

"I would've never imagined that the day I saw you on the bus it'd lead me here. If you'd told me I'd be here a week ago, I'd never have believed it."

It takes a minute for his words to sink in,

"Wait, what? The day you saw me on the bus, what about it?"

"Remember, the tattoos, on the bus when I dropped you off?"

"Yeah of course I remember that day, it was my first time leaving the academy premises, but what does that have to do with you being here?" I turn to fully face him.

He opens his mouth, but nothing comes out at first as if he's lost for words,

"After I dropped you off I completed my shift cycle and then...I came back to the academy. I'd been there before, I just never knew that someone who's been branded like me was there. I've been curious about this for the longest time and I was trying to find you to see if you had answers. And coincidently, in my search, I ran into Shayla, we did some-"

"Wait Shayla? You came across Shayla? You mean Shayla is- has a-?" I couldn't believe what I was hearing, of course she had to be tattooed too. Of course she had to, this is Shayla we're talking about, how could I believe that she'd be off my case in anything.

"Yes, she's marked, like us."

But how? My eyes instantly darted to the front of the bus where Shayla was sat next to Miles and somehow hadn't provoked him and gotten herself thrown out the window yet.

How did she get her branding? We've shared every day of our life for as long as I can remember, how could I not have found out about this?

"The first time I came to the academy I dropped you off and left. But I recognized the place; I was supposed to be assigned to this academy a long time ago. When I realized you might be related to the markings- I wanted to get some answers. I figured if I'd find you, I don't know, I might get some answers. So I came to the academy looking for you, and I ran into Shayla. Long story short, turns out she's marked too...and we might've, um...kept a close eye on you and Kernel...and now we're all here."

He's still looking at me with those eyes, twinkling and mesmerizing, digging deep into my own awaiting a response.

"Wow. I'm not gonna lie, that was unexpected. How come you guys didn't just confront us from the start?"

"I don't know, Shayla said it might be a bad idea or something, something about you two being irrational drama queens." He flashes a playful smile.

"She said we're irrational drama queens?" If we weren't heading into a highly-guarded building on a life threatening mission, I might've actually went up to the front of the bus and thrown her out the bus myself.

"To be fair I don't think that you are." he adds,

"To be fair I don't think that you're a drama queen either." I say and we both laugh.

As our laughter slowly dies down, my eyes land on his revealed wrist, various arches etched on his tan skin.

He notices me looking, "I made some changes to it," he says as he lifts his arm and places it between us, his wrist facing the both of us.

"I know a guy who was able to make some changes to the original tattoo I'd gotten at the government center. I didn't like the idea of the government owning me like that. Something about the marking felt wrong from the moment I got it. So, I had him add arches to the original, they were supposed to be dragon scales and he was going to eventually draw out a miniature dragon that extends to here." He drags his finger across his wrist to show me.

"But the guy disappeared shortly after. And that's when I began searching for answers."

His eyes shift focus from his wrist tattoo and back to me.

"What's yours look like?" He asks.

The uniforms we were handed out earlier today were full-sleeved, some people in our unit had pulled their sleeves up like Cyrus had, to accommodate the heat and humidity in the bus as our crammed bodies pumped out heat in the small space. But I hadn't bothered pulling mine up, my mind too preoccupied with other things, but now that he was asking, it occurred to me that I never paid much attention to what the tattoo actually looked like. I'd been so busy trying to hide it out of fear, I never took a proper look at it.

I slowly started to pull my sleeve up, keenly aware of Cyrus' gaze lingering on my wrist as the triangle etching came into view. Without notice, Cyrus's hands were suddenly over my wrist, touching it, holding it. One hand held my wrist, the other traced the delicate markings. Strangely enough, something about my arm being in his hand felt right, and I wondered if he felt it too. His hand radiated warmth, and I wished he'd keep on holding it for the rest of the ride. He traced the outline of the triangle, then moved on to the more delicate details drawn inside of it; a collection of minuscule geometric shapes.

To me it looked like a bunch of squares and lines and circles, but Cyrus was so concentrated on the etchings as he traced them, as if seeing something worth contemplating. His fingers lingered for a bit, and then he let go of my hand and the warmth was gone.

"That's interesting, they have no similarities." He says placing his arm next to mine, arms nearly touching.

Side by side, the drawings look completely different: one is more circular, the other clearly a triangle. Mine is filled with geometric shapes, his is filled with patterns. My arm is pulsing with an electric-like feeling at the proximity, but I try to ignore it as I scrutinize his tattoo more.

"What about these lines?" I ask noticing a set of matching small etchings visible on both of our wrists.

"Which ones?"

I touch a set of especially small lines on the side of one of the curves of the dragon's scale that's permanently engraved into his skin.

"There's six of them." I say, then proceed to count seven on mine. The lines were so small, yet despite this, their discernible height was easy to make out.

"None of them are the same height." Cyrus says as if reading my mind.

The only thing I could think of,

"Barcodes." We say at the same time.

"That's crazy. We'll have to investigate what this could mean once this mission is over." He says pulling his arm away.

"That's if we make it out alive today." I say tugging my sleeve back down despite the heat.

"C'mon have some faith, how hard can it be."
